We’re looking for a software engineer who is comfortable working beyond conventional application boundaries. You’ll contribute to everything from drivers and communication services running on embedded Linux hardware to backend systems, data pipelines, and the interfaces used by customers and operators. You’ll collaborate directly with hardware engineers and develop software that controls and monitors physical systems deployed in the field. If you enjoy work where software has real-world consequences—and where debugging sometimes involves a multimeter—this role is for you. This role is Hybrid in local market (Torrance and commutable surrounding areas) Responsibilities: - Design and build software spanning embedded drivers, device communications, backend services, data pipelines, and operator-facing interfaces - Develop the network communication and driver layers that power our site controllers and distributed energy resources - Build and maintain automated data pipelines for utility interval data analysis and real-time energy monitoring - Collaborate with hardware engineers to develop and iterate on embedded system designs - Help architect systems that are reliable, observable, maintainable, and deployable across physically distributed sites - Participate in hardware bring-up, field testing, commissioning, and debugging of deployed systems - Own features from initial design through deployment and field validation Requirements: - Proficiency in one or more systems programming languages, such as C, C++, or Rust - Experience with a higher-level language used for services, automation, or data processing, such as Python or Go - Experience writing firmware, drivers, or hardware-facing software for embedded targets - Comfort working close to hardware, including reading schematics, debugging over serial or JTAG, and reasoning about timing and electrical behavior - Experience building backend services and APIs, ideally for real-time, distributed, or telemetry-driven systems - Ability to take ownership of ambiguous problems and operate with minimal oversight in a fast-moving startup environment Preferred Requirements: - Familiarity with industrial protocols such as Modbus, DNP3, or CAN bus - Experience with SCADA systems, distributed energy resources, or industrial controls - Experience with battery energy storage systems, inverters, power conversion equipment, or other grid-edge hardware - Background in aerospace, defense, robotics, automotive, or other safety-critical embedded domains - Exposure to machine learning, signal processing, controls, or data analysis in a hardware context - A degree in physics, computer engineering, electrical engineering, or a related technical discipline Work Authorization We are not able to offer visa sponsorship for this role.
